Hello guys, i have questions for those who already filed for AOS and for those who are in process or anyone who knows. IS there any time frame when to file adjustment of status? Is it really mandatory to apply it within the 90 days from entry here in US? or did anyone/anybody who applied more those 90 days. I admit the fact that money is the real hindrance to apply right away.we are still saving for it. Can anyone pls answer my question, i really appreciate it.Thank you and God bless.

Hi there, it's been 8 months since my I-94 expired, money was the problem too.. and finally I'm filing mine tomorrow!! You're good sis, I have asked about this at every forum I could get on, it's ok if it'll be late than 90 days. They just recommend to file for AOS within that time frame for status wise. I have read somewhere that a couple haven't filed yet, and it's been a year already..

welcome.. with your SSN, I wonder why you can't get yours, I got one a month after I got here, all you have to is show them your I-94.. then I went back to their office the day after we got married to have my SSN changed to my married name, and I was able to, because it was just exactly 2 weeks before my I-94 expires.. That's weird if they say you're not allowed to apply for one. I read somewhere here that some SSN offices don't know that they can issue SSN for K1 visa holders, that could be a reason why. What I did was printed out a file at SS website that says they issue SSN for K visa holders, I have it in my hand to show in case the person we're going to talk to don't know about it, but we got a very nice lady that knows about it.

Well for SSN true some don't know you are allowed to apply for it, so it would be good to print out informations stating that you are allowed to apply for one, if you click on the guides above you ll get informations covering that, the only problem you ll have is if your I-94 is about expiring then they would ask you to wait to adjust status first before applying.

Well goodluck either way.

PS applying for ssn after marriage isnt a problem, if you take your marriage certificate along with you, they ll document it and whats better? you get your ssn in your marriage name.
